A 2009 Chevy Traverse was fished out of Foster Reservoir Saturday by Franklin County Search & Rescue.

Franklin County Sheriff’s Office responded to a call on Saturday, Aug. 26, that a vehicle had entered Foster Reservoir.

Jeremy Chatterley had exited his vehicle to help his wife, Lacey. But he only got the vehicle into neutral, not park.

The 2009 Chevy Traverse simply rolled into the reservoir and sunk. There were no occupants in the car.

Franklin County Search and Rescue was called to help locate the vehicle and Boyd Burbank, a member of the unit, spent an hour looking for it in the murky waters, said his son, TJ Burbank.

After a couple more hours of determining the best way to connect to the vehicle, it was pulled out, upside down.

Spatig’s Towing pulled the vehicle from the water. It was considered a total loss.
